The worldwide molecular breast imaging market is projected to grow at a compound annual growth rate (CAGR) of 6.9%, reaching a value of US$1,246.6 million by the conclusion of 2030, up from US$781.4 million in 2023.

Key Insights:

  • Molecular Breast Imaging Market Size (2023E): US$781.4 Mn
  • Projected Market Value (2030F): US$1,246.6 Mn
  • Global Market Growth Rate (CAGR 2023 to 2030): 6.9%
  • Historical Market Growth Rate (CAGR 2018 to 2022): 6.1%

Molecular Breast Imaging Market - Report Scope

Molecular breast imaging (MBI) is a specialized technique for diagnosing breast cancer, employing a radioactive tracer and gamma camera to detect cellular activity in breast tissues. It offers enhanced accuracy, particularly for women with dense breast tissue. The market is growing due to increased breast cancer incidence, technological advancements, and improved patient outcomes associated with MBI.

Market Growth Drivers

Advancements in imaging technology are driving the molecular breast imaging market, with increasingly sophisticated MBI systems offering better sensitivity and resolution. These innovations, including digital detectors and advanced algorithms, enhance early cancer detection and overcome challenges posed by dense breast tissue. Additionally, the growing focus on personalized medicine is boosting MBI adoption, as it provides precise assessments for tailored treatment plans, aligning with the trend towards individualized healthcare solutions.

Market Restraints

Compliance, safety, budgetary limitations, and accessibility hurdles pose challenges for the molecular breast imaging market. Regulatory obstacles, radiation concerns, high costs, and uneven facility distribution hinder widespread adoption. Solutions require constant innovation, strict safety measures, strategic pricing, partnerships, and creative funding approaches.

Opportunities

Expanding the applications of molecular breast imaging beyond breast cancer screening opens new opportunities for the market. Research and development efforts could explore its potential in detecting various malignancies or medical conditions as they develop, extending its diagnostic capabilities beyond breast tissue. This diversification enables medical imaging manufacturers to tap into new markets and broaden their offerings. Furthermore, the integration of Artificial Intelligence (AI) with molecular breast imaging enhances diagnostic accuracy and efficiency. AI systems can quickly analyze MBI images, aiding in the detection of subtle abnormalities and accelerating diagnosis. Collaboration between MBI manufacturers and AI technology developers fosters the creation of intelligent diagnostic tools, improving patient outcomes and positioning businesses at the forefront of advanced imaging technology.
